Move Over Bard: This Minstrel Offers Customized Songwriting

The rise of artificial intelligence in various industries has been nothing short of remarkable, and now it’s making waves in the world of songwriting. The traditional bard has long been associated with the art of composing and performing songs for special occasions, but with the advent of AI technology, a new kind of minstrel has emerged, offering customized songwriting at a fraction of the cost. This development has the potential to revolutionize the way we create and experience music, making it more accessible and affordable for everyone.

One company serves as an example of how AI technology can be integrated into the composing process and the art of gifting. With co-founder, Mylène Besançon at the helm and a team of musicians and songwriters, Bring My Song to Life makes the experience of commissioning a tailored song more accessible to the budget friendly with a price of $49. By integrating advanced algorithms into the music production process, the company can create songs that are not only unique and personalized but also easy on the wallet. The AI-generated songs include tailored lyrics and are sung by virtual singers, allowing clients to customize the genre, mood, and personal touches in the lyrics. This approach sets Bring My Song to Life apart from its competitors, which rely on extensive networks of musicians, often leading to higher prices for the end consumer.

However, Bring My Song to Life acknowledges that there will always be a demand for human musicians and the artistry they bring to the table. To cater to clients who prefer a more traditional approach, the company also offers the option of having their personalized songs created by real musicians, starting at $99. This dual approach allows Bring My Song to Life to serve a broader audience, accommodating different preferences and budgets while ensuring that the unique and heartwarming experience of gifting personalized music remains accessible to all.

Advantages of Integrating AI into Musical Composition

The integration of artificial intelligence into musical composition offers numerous advantages that extend beyond mere cost savings. For one, AI-powered music composition can significantly speed up the creative process, helping to generate melodies, harmonies, and rhythms in a matter of seconds. This allows composers and songwriters to quickly experiment with various ideas, enabling them to explore new musical territories and push the boundaries of their creativity. As AI algorithms become increasingly sophisticated, they can analyze vast amounts of musical data to identify patterns and trends, which can then inspire unique and innovative compositions.

Another advantage of AI integration in musical composition is its potential to democratize the music-making process. By providing an affordable and accessible platform for creating music, AI-driven tools can empower people who may not have access to traditional musical resources, such as costly instruments or formal music education. These tools can also help individuals overcome various barriers to entry, such as the steep learning curve associated with mastering an instrument or composing music from scratch. In essence, AI in musical composition has the potential to level the playing field and enable a broader range of people to participate in the creative process, fostering a more diverse and inclusive musical landscape.

Samsung develops industry's fastest DRAM chip for AI applications

In a groundbreaking development, Samsung has announced the creation of the industry’s first low-power double data rate 5X (LPDDR5X) DRAM chip for AI applications. The new chip boasts high performance of up to 10.7 Gbps, marking a significant improvement in both speed and capacity compared to previous models.

Low-power, high-performance LPDDR chips are becoming increasingly important in the on-device AI market. Samsung’s latest LPDDR5X products, developed with 12 nanometer-class process technology, are the smallest in size among existing LPDDR chips, further cementing the company’s position as a leader in the low-power DRAM sector.

A company spokesperson stated, “Samsung will continue to innovate and deliver optimized products for the upcoming on-device AI era through close collaboration with customers.” Mass production of the LPDDR5X is set to commence in the second half of the year, pending verification by mobile application processor and device providers.

PM Modi showed keen interest in our model of rural development: Zoho's Sridhar Vembu

New Delhi, April 17 (IANS) – Zoho Founder and CEO, Sridhar Vembu, revealed that Prime Minister Narendra Modi expressed interest in Zoho’s rural development model in Tenkasi district, Tamil Nadu during his recent meeting. PM Modi praised the company’s efforts in creating high-tech capabilities and jobs in rural areas.

During an election rally in Ambasamudram, PM Modi met Vembu to discuss Zoho’s rural development through R&D model. Vembu expressed gratitude towards PM Modi for taking the time to understand and appreciate the company’s operations in Tenkasi as a model of rural development.

“PM Modi came to Ambasamudram which is close to my village. Even in the middle of his hectic campaign schedule, he gave me time to meet him and brief him on our rural development through R&D model and on creating high-tech capability and jobs in rural areas,” Vembu shared on social media.

Vembu highlighted that PM Modi showed keen interest in Zoho’s Tenkasi operations. He praised the Prime Minister’s leadership and expressed his support for his continued health and service to the nation. Zoho, founded in 1996 and headquartered in Chennai, employs over 15,000 individuals globally.

During his rally in Ambasamudram, PM Modi criticized the DMK in Tamil Nadu, alleging that they conspired with the Congress to hand over the Katchatheevu island to a foreign nation. PM Modi emphasized his commitment to developing a ‘Viksit Tamil Nadu’ along with a ‘Viksit Bharat’ for overall progress.

Healthcare platform MediBuddy achieves break-even in FY24

New Delhi, April 17 (IANS) Digital healthcare platform MediBuddy has announced that it has reached break-even with a marginal loss in the previous fiscal year, moving towards EBITDA neutrality. The company has seen a significant increase in its user base by 2.4 times over the last three years, serving close to 3 crore people with over 1 crore subscribers.

According to Satish Kannan, Co-founder and CEO of MediBuddy, “By leveraging technology, our platform enhances doctor-patient interactions, fueling remarkable growth and expanding healthcare access nationwide.” The company is now focusing on exploring mergers and acquisitions opportunities in key healthcare areas such as chronic disease management, mental health, diabetes, women’s care, and weight management, supported by an $18 million capital pool.

MediBuddy has a network of over 90,000 doctors across more than 22 specialities, and works with over 7,100 hospitals and clinics. The company has also onboarded over 10,000 hospitals and diagnostic centers for all radiology and pathology investigations. Kannan stated, “We empower doctors through our platform, offering accessible care via video consultations, hospital visits, clinics, pharmacy deliveries, and diagnostic services.”
